Understanding Website Speed
Website speed refers to how quickly your web pages load and become fully interactive for users. However, measuring speed involves several key metrics that paint a complete picture of performance.
Page load time represents the total time it takes for a webpage to display all its content. But modern websites load progressively, making other metrics equally important. First Contentful Paint (FCP) measures when users first see content appear on screen, while Largest Contentful Paint (LCP) tracks when the main content finishes loading. Time to Interactive (TTI) indicates when pages become fully functional for user interaction.
Several factors influence these speed metrics. Server response time affects how quickly your hosting provider delivers content requests. Large, unoptimized images often account for the majority of page weight, significantly slowing load times. Excessive or poorly written CSS and JavaScript code create additional delays. HTTP requests—the communications between browsers and servers—multiply the loading time when pages require numerous external resources.
Network conditions and device capabilities also impact perceived speed. Mobile users on slower connections experience different performance than desktop users with high-speed internet. Understanding these variables helps prioritize which optimization techniques will deliver the greatest improvements.
Why Website Speed Matters
User experience suffers dramatically when websites load slowly. Research consistently shows that bounce rates increase exponentially with longer load times. Google’s data reveals that bounce rates jump to 32% when pages take three seconds to load, climbing to 90% at five seconds. Users expect instant gratification online, and slow websites create frustration that drives visitors to competitors.
SEO rankings depend heavily on page speed, especially since Google’s Page Experience update made Core Web Vitals official ranking factors. Search engines prioritize fast-loading pages because they deliver better user experiences. Websites that improve their speed often see improved search visibility and organic traffic growth.
The business impact extends to conversion rates and revenue. E-commerce sites particularly benefit from speed optimization, as shopping experiences require multiple page interactions. Walmart discovered that improving page load time by one second increased conversions by 2%. Pinterest reduced load times by 40% and saw a 15% increase in search engine traffic and sign-ups.
Mobile users face even greater speed expectations. Google’s mobile-first indexing means your mobile page speed directly affects search rankings. With mobile traffic accounting for over half of web usage, optimizing for mobile speed has become crucial for online success.
How to Optimize Website Speed
Optimize Images
Images typically represent 60-70% of total page weight, making image optimization the most impactful speed improvement strategy. Start by choosing appropriate file formats: JPEG for photographs, PNG for graphics with transparency, and WebP for modern browsers supporting this efficient format.
Compress images without sacrificing visual quality using tools like TinyPNG or ImageOptim. Implement responsive images that serve different sizes based on device screens, preventing mobile users from downloading unnecessarily large files. Consider lazy loading, which delays image loading until users scroll near them, reducing initial page load time.
Leverage Browser Caching
Browser caching stores website files locally on users’ devices, eliminating the need to re-download unchanged content during return visits. Configure caching headers to specify how long browsers should store different file types. Static resources like CSS, JavaScript, and images can be cached for extended periods, while HTML files might require shorter cache durations.

Set appropriate expiration dates for cached content. CSS and JavaScript files can often be cached for a year, while images might be cached for several months. This technical SEO technique dramatically improves the repeat visitor experience and reduces server load.
Minify CSS, JavaScript, and HTML
Code minification removes unnecessary characters like spaces, comments, and line breaks without affecting functionality. This process reduces file sizes and improves page load time. Many content management systems offer plugins for automatic minification, while developers can use build tools like Webpack or Gulp.
Combine multiple CSS or JavaScript files when possible to reduce HTTP requests. However, balance this with HTTP/2 capabilities, which handle multiple small files more efficiently than older protocols. Consider critical CSS inlining for above-the-fold content to eliminate render-blocking resources.
Choose a Fast Hosting Provider
Your hosting provider’s infrastructure directly impacts server response time and overall website speed. Shared hosting plans often struggle with performance due to resource limitations and server overcrowding. Consider upgrading to VPS, dedicated servers, or cloud hosting for better performance.
Content Delivery Networks (CDNs) distribute your website’s files across multiple geographic locations, serving content from servers closest to each visitor. Popular CDN services like Cloudflare or AWS CloudFront can significantly reduce load times for global audiences.
Tools for Measuring Website Speed
Regular speed testing identifies performance issues and tracks improvement progress. Several free tools provide comprehensive website speed analysis.
Google PageSpeed Insights offers detailed performance scores for both mobile and desktop versions of your pages. This tool provides specific optimization recommendations and measures Core Web Vitals metrics that affect SEO rankings. The real-world performance data helps understand how actual users experience your website.
GTmetrix combines Google Lighthouse data with additional performance insights. It provides waterfall charts showing exactly how page elements load, making it easier to identify bottlenecks. GTmetrix also offers historical performance tracking to monitor improvements over time.
WebPageTest allows advanced testing from multiple locations and browsers, providing detailed breakdowns of loading processes. This tool offers filmstrip views showing visual loading progress and comprehensive technical data for thorough analysis.
Test your website regularly using multiple tools to get comprehensive performance insights. Different tools may highlight various issues, and consistent monitoring helps maintain optimal speed as you add new content or features.
